Atrichia with Papular Lesions, also known as papular atrichia, is related to alopecia universalis congenita and alopecia. An important gene associated with Atrichia with Papular Lesions is HR (HR Lysine Demethylase And Nuclear Receptor Corepressor), and among its related pathways/superpathways are Nervous system development and Keratinization. Affiliated tissues include skin and thyroid, and related phenotypes are sparse hair and generalized papillary lesions
